Explosion at Waste Management Site Creates Massive Fireball in Oxfordshire

2023-10-02 20:33:55

An impressive column of fire appeared north of the city of Oxford in England. This appeared following an explosion on the site of a waste management company.

A huge ball of fire was observed this Monday, October 2 in the county of Oxford in the United Kingdom, while several witnesses spoke of an explosion in the region, report several Anglo-Saxon media including Sky News.

A waste management site hit by lightning

Several images have been circulating in recent minutes on social networks where testimonies are multiplying concerning this column of fire which was observed to the northwest of the city of Oxford.

According to the local tabloid Oxford Mail, the fire broke out at the site of a waste management company, near the town of Yarnton. “This evening, a digester at our Cassington plant, near Yarnton, Oxfordshire, was struck by lightning, causing an explosion in our biogas tanks,” the company confirmed on its Facebook account in the evening.

“Fortunately no one was injured,” added Severn Trent Power, “we are working with the emergency services to ensure the safety of the site and to assess the extent of the damage as quickly as possible.”

Thames Valley Police have confirmed that officers are at the scene.
